INSPECTION AFTER REMOVAL

Camshaft Runout

1. Put V block on precise flat work bench, and support No. 1 and

No. 5 journals of the camshaft.

2. Set dial indicator vertically to No. 3 journal.
3. Turn the camshaft to one direction, and measure the camshaft

runout on dial indicator (total indicator reading).

• If measurement exceeds specification, replace the camshaft.

Camshaft Cam Height

• Measure the camshaft cam height.

• If measurement is not within the specifications, replace the cam-

shaft.

Camshaft Journal Clearance

 Camshaft Journal Diameter

• Measure the diameter of the camshaft journal.

Camshaft Bracket Inner Diameter

• Tighten the camshaft bracket bolt to the specified torque.

• Measure the inner diameter (A) of the camshaft bracket.

Calculation of Camshaft Journal Clearance

(Journal clearance) = (camshaft bracket inner diameter) – (camshaft

journal diameter)

• If measurement is not within specification, replace either or both

camshaft and cylinder head.

Camshaft runout

: Less than 0.02 mm (0.0008 in)

EMK0641D

Standard cam height 
(intake)

: 44.865 - 45.055 mm 
(1.7663 - 1.7738 in)

Standard cam height (ex-
haust)

: 45.075 - 45.265 mm 
(1.7746 - 1.7821 in)

Cam wear limit
(intake & exhaust)

: 0.02 mm (0.0008 in)

PBIC0039E

Standard diameter : 25.950 - 25.970 mm 

(1.0217 - 1.0224 in)

PBIC0040E

Standard

: 26.000 - 26.021 mm (1.0236 - 1.0244 in)

Standard

: 0.030 - 0.071 mm (0.0012 - 0.0028 in)

NOTE:

The inner diameter of the camshaft bracket is manufactured together with the cylinder head. Replace the

whole cylinder head as an assembly.

Camshaft End Play

• Install dial gauge in the thrust direction on the front end of the cam-

shaft. Measure the end play when the camshaft is moved forward/

backward (in direction to axis).

• If measurement is out of the specified range, replace the camshaft

and measure again.

• If measurement is still out of the specified range, replace the cylin-

der head.

• Measure the following parts if end play is outside the specified

value.

- Dimension 

A

 for camshaft No. 1 journal

- Dimension 

B

 for cylinder head No. 1 journal

• If measurements are not within specification, replace the camshaft

and/or cylinder head.

Camshaft Sprocket Runout

1. Install the camshaft in the cylinder head.
2. Install the camshaft sprocket to the camshaft.
3. Measure the camshaft sprocket runout.

• If measurement exceeds the specification, replace the cam-

shaft sprocket.

Valve Lifter

Check if the surface of the valve lifter has any wear or cracks.

• If any damage is found, replace the valve lifter.

• Select the thickness of the head so that the valve clearance is

within the standard when replacing. Refer to 

EM-198, "Inspection

after Installation"

.

Valve Lifter Clearance

 Valve Lifter Diameter

 

Standard

: 0.115 - 0.188 mm (0.0045 - 0.0074 in)

PBIC0042E

Standard

: 30.500 - 30.548 mm (1.2008-1.2027 in)

Standard

: 30.360 - 30.385 mm (1.1953-1.1963 in)

KBIA2426J

Runout

: Less than 0.15 mm (0.0059 in)

KBIA0181J

• Measure the diameter of the valve lifter.

Valve Lifter Hole Diameter

• Measure the diameter of the valve lifter hole of the cylinder head,

using suitable tool.

Calculation of Valve Lifter Clearance

(Valve lifter clearance) = (valve lifter hole diameter) – (valve lifter

diameter)

• If the measurement is not within specification, referring to each

specification of the valve lifter diameter and hole diameter, replace

either or both the valve lifter and cylinder head.

INSTALLATION

1. Install the valve lifters if removed.

• Install removed parts in their original locations.

2. Install the camshafts. Use the table below for identification of the

RH and LH, and intake and exhaust.

• Install so that the RH bank (B) dowel pins (A) and LH bank (C)

dowel pins (A) at the front of the camshaft face are in the

direction shown.

Standard

: 33.977 - 33.987 mm (1.3377 - 1.3381 in)

JEM798G

Standard

: 34.000 - 34.016 mm (1.3386 - 1.3392 in)

Standard

: 0.013 - 0.039 mm (0.0005 - 0.0015 in)

5. Install the camshaft sprockets using the following procedure:

• A: LH bank shown

a. Install the camshaft sprockets aligning them with the matching

marks painted on the timing chain (B) and the camshaft sprock-

ets (C) before removal. Align the camshaft sprocket key groove

with the dowel pin on the camshaft front edge at the same time.

Then temporarily tighten camshaft sprocket bolts.

• Install the intake VTC (A) and exhaust (B) side camshaft

sprockets by selectively using the groove of the dowel pin

according to the bank for the exhaust (B) side camshaft

sprockets. (Common part used for both exhaust banks.)

NOTE:

Use the groove marked (R) for RH bank and (L) for LH bank.

b. Lock the hexagonal part of the camshaft in the same way as for

removal, and tighten the camshaft sprocket bolts.

c.

Check again that the timing alignment mark on the timing chain

and on each sprocket are aligned.

6. Install the chain tensioner using the following procedure:

NOTE:

LH is shown.

a. Install the chain tensioner.

• Compress the plunger and hold it using a stopper pin when

installing.

• Loosen the slack guide side timing chain by rotating the cam-

shaft hexagonal part if mounting space is small.

b. Remove the stopper pin and release the plunger to apply ten-

sion to the timing chain.

c.

Install the chain tensioner cover onto the front cover.

• Apply liquid gasket as shown.

Use Genuine RTV Silicone Sealant or equivalent. Refer to

GI-14, "Recommended Chemical Products and Sealants"

.

7. Check and adjust valve clearances. Refer to 

EM-198, "Inspec-

tion after Installation"

.

8. Installation of the remaining components is in the reverse order

of removal.

Inspection after Installation

INFOID:0000000005260524

INSPECTION OF CAMSHAFT SPROCKET (INT) OIL GROOVE

WARNING:

Check when engine is cold so as to prevent burns from any splashing engine oil.

CAUTION:

AWBIA0152ZZ

AWBIA0151ZZ

Chain tensioner bolts

: 6.9 N·m (0.70 kg-m, 61 in-lb)

Chain tensioner cover 
bolts

: 9.0 N·m (0.92 kg-m, 80 in-lb)

KBIA2479E

KBIA2547E

2010 Pathfinder

CAMSHAFT

EM-199

< ON-VEHICLE REPAIR >

[VK56DE]

C

D

E

F

G

H

I

J

K

L

M

A

EM

N

P

O

• Perform this inspection only when DTC P0011 is detected in self-diagnostic results of CONSULT III

and it is directed according to inspection procedure of EC section. Refer to 

EC-585, "Component

Inspection"

.

1. Check engine oil level. Refer to 

LU-24, "Inspection"

.

2. Perform the following procedure so as to prevent the engine from being unintentionally started while

checking.

a. Release fuel pressure. Refer to 

EC-958, "Fuel Pressure Check"

.

b. Disconnect ignition coil and injector harness connectors if practical.
3. Remove IVT control solenoid valve.
4. Crank engine, and then make sure that engine oil comes out from IVT control cover oil hole. End cranking

after checking.

WARNING:

Be careful not to touch rotating parts (drive belts, idler pulley, and crankshaft pulley, etc.).

CAUTION:

• Engine oil may squirt from IVT control solenoid valve installation hole during cranking. Use a

shop cloth to prevent engine oil from splashing on worker, engine components and vehicle. 

• Do not allow engine oil to get on rubber components such as drive belts or engine mount insula-

tors. Immediately wipe off any splashed engine oil.

5. Clean oil groove between oil strainer and IVT control solenoid valve if engine oil does not come out from

IVT control valve cover oil hole. Refer to 

LU-23, "System Chart"

.

6. Remove components between IVT control solenoid valve and camshaft sprocket (INT), and then check

each oil groove for clogging.

• Clean oil groove if necessary. 

7. After inspection, installation of the remaining components is in the reverse order of removal.
